Key Dates for the Soul Fighter Event 2023
The eagerly awaited Soul Fighter event commences on July 20 with the rollout of patch 13.14 and continues for a total of six weeks until August 28. An exhilarating summer packed with intense fights and intriguing missions awaits the League of Legends community.
Pricing Details for the Event Pass
While Riot Games has yet to officially announce the pricing of the Soul Fighter 2023 pass, estimates suggest it will be set at 1,650 Riot Points. For those hunting for extra cosmetics, the pass bundle might be available at 2,650 RP. The bundle is expected to include a skin, an icon, and a border.
A Sneak Peek into the Tournament of Souls
The Soul Fighter event sees the launch of ‘Tournament of Souls,’ a stylish fighting game within the League of Legends client. Players adopt the persona of Samira, earning Reputation points by participating in League matches. As players accumulate points and confront new opponents, they unlock additional abilities for Samira. This paves the way for them to progress further into the tournament, with one player eventually triumphing over all ten opponents to be declared the champion.
